CCDE: Cisco Certified Design Expert (Practical) — Question 3
Company XYZ is planning to deploy primary and secondary (disaster recovery) data center sites. Each of these sites will have redundant SAN fabrics and data protection is expected between the data center sites. The sites are 100 miles (160 km) apart and target RPO/RTO are 3 hrs and 24 hrs, respectively. Which two considerations must Company XYZ bear in mind when deploying replication in their scenario? (Choose two.)
Answer options
- A. Target RPO/RTO requirements cannot be met due to the one-way delay introduced by the distance between sites.
- B. VSANs must be extended from the primary to the secondary site to improve performance and availability.
- C. VSANs must be routed between sites to isolate fault domains and increase overall availability.
- D. Synchronous data replication must be used to meet the business requirements.
- E. Asynchronous data replication should be used in this scenario to avoid performance impact in the primary site.
Correct answer: C, E
Explanation
Option C is correct because routing VSANs between sites helps isolate fault domains, which enhances overall availability. Option E is also correct since asynchronous replication minimizes performance impacts on the primary site, making it suitable for the distance involved. Options A and D are incorrect as they either misinterpret the impact of distance on RPO/RTO or suggest synchronous replication, which may not be feasible given the distance.
